Modern high energy density lithium ion solutions aren't your dad's AA batteries. They're more like chemical rock stars, using:
Tesla's 4680 battery cells (used in Cybertruck) contain 90% nickel in their NMC (Nickel Manganese Cobalt) cathodes. Why? Nickel stores 10x more lithium ions than old-school cobalt designs. It's like upgrading from a scooter to a Ferrari in the ion highway department.
Here's the catch - silicon anodes can store 10x more lithium ions than graphite... but expand like marshmallows in a microwave. Companies like Sila Nano solved this with "nanoscale silicon sponges" that swell gracefully, boosting capacity by 20% without popcorn-style explosions.
Lithium-ion batteries can be divas – one wrong move and they throw a fiery tantrum. Solid-state solutions (like QuantumScape's ceramic separators) act like bouncers, preventing dendrite troublemakers while enabling faster charging. Imagine juicing up your EV in 15 minutes flat!

Car makers are scrambling like Black Friday shoppers for better batteries. BMW's Neue Klasse platform uses cylindrical cells with 30% more energy density. Meanwhile, Chinese EV maker NIO offers battery-as-a-service swaps – because who has time to wait for charging?
The future's so bright, we'll need polarized battery coatings. Here's the 2024 cheat sheet:
SES AI's Apollo cells promise 400 Wh/kg density – enough for 600-mile EV ranges. That's like driving from Paris to Berlin without stopping... or yawning.
Researchers at Texas A&M created a battery that decomposes in seawater. Perfect for naval drones – and way better than leaving toxic souvenirs in the ocean.
Startups like Chemix use machine learning to predict battery aging patterns. It's like having a crystal ball that whispers: "Replace cell #43 before it ruins your camping trip."
